5 Ways To Make Your Journey Work For You

Whether it’s for work or for pleasure, there is no doubt that you will spend some time travelling this summer. So whether it’s a flight to Spain or a train journey to Ramsbottom, here are some tips to make sure you don’t waste a second of your journey.

1. Have a plan. Prioritising your work will help you complete urgent tasks before getting on with the more mundane tasks.

2. Make sure all your files are accessible offline. While it may seem obvious, it is easy to forget which files are on your computer and which are just on your emails.

3. Clear the backlog. If there are a lot of distractions or you are tired, use the time to clear out your inbox and even plan work for when you arrive.

4. Have a 50 minute brainstorm. All you need is a pen, a sheet of A4 paper and 50 minutes. Think of every task you have to do, no matter how large or small, and write them all down. Then go through an prioritise the tasks.

5. Make a plan of action on how to tackle your biggest problem. Its easy to put off the tough decisions or risky tasks. Use this time to figure out your ‘how to’ guide on how to get it done.

The time you spend travelling can either be written off completely or used to do the things you normally don’t get a chance to do.
